About This Book

This clown isn’t just any clown—he has a giant elephant friend who makes every day an unforgettable adventure. Together, they turn ordinary moments into laughter and surprises, proving that friendship can come in the most unexpected pairs. What wild fun awaits when a clown and an elephant team up?

Quick Assessment

This charming early reader book features a playful clown and his elephant friend, designed for children ages 5 to 8. With simple text and engaging illustrations, it supports early literacy while introducing themes of friendship and imagination. The content is gentle and appropriate for young readers, making it a delightful choice for beginning readers.

Why we rated Clown and elephant 7C

Clown and elephant is written at a Level 2 reading level across 8 pages. Strong independent readers around grade 3.0 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Clown and elephant works for readers up to grade 4.0.

We rate Clown and elephant as 7C ("Clear") because the content sits in the "Gentle" range — no conflict beyond everyday childhood experiences. Across our four dimensions (emotional, physical, social, thematic) the book reads as evenly gentle; no single dimension stands out as a concern.

No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the gentle intensity score.

Thematically, Clown and elephant explores friendship, humor, adventure, and juvenile fiction —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
